First discovered in the late 1980s in the Brazilian state of Paraíba from which the stone is named, Paraíba tourmaline is arguably the most valuable, and perhaps the most popular, of all tourmaline gem varieties. Though Africa also produces Paraíba tourmalines nowadays, Brazil remains home to the most sought-after Paraíba in the world. However, the supply has been dwindling and a Paraíba over 3 carats like this one offered here is considered an extremely rare occurrence.
